What do accountants do?

Accountants help manage finances for businesses and individuals. Common services include:

  • Day-to-day bookkeeping: Recording income/expenses, processing payroll, managing accounts payable/receivable
  • Reporting: Preparing financial statements, cash flow reports, profit/loss statements
  • Taxes: Tax planning and preparation, filing returns, resolving audits
  • Auditing: Reviewing financial records to verify accuracy and compliance
  • Advising: Budgeting, reducing costs, improving profits, managing cash flow
  • Compliance: Ensuring legal/regulatory standards are met, documenting processes
  • Systems: Implementing accounting software/controls appropriate for the organization

How much do accountants charge?

Accountant fees vary widely based on several factors:

  • Location: Accountants in major metropolitan areas tend to charge higher rates, averaging $150 to $400 per hour. In smaller towns, rates may range from $100 to 250 per hour.
  • Experience level: Newly certified or junior accountants typically charge $50 to $150 per hour. Senior accountants with 5 to 10 years of experience charge $200 to $500 per hour on average.
  • Firm size: Solo practitioners and small local firms often have lower rates compared to larger regional or national firms.
  • Specializations: Accountants with niche expertise like forensic accounting or international taxes command higher rates.
  • Services: Commonly outsourced services like payroll, bookkeeping, and tax prep tend to cost less per hour than consultative services like auditing and financial planning.

Expect to pay $150 to $1,800+ for tax prep, $2,000 to $25,000+ for auditing, and $200 to $1,000 per month for bookkeeping, depending on your business size and needs. Request free consultations and compare detailed estimates before hiring.

How is an accountant different from a bookkeeper?

Bookkeepers handle daily transactions like recording expenses or issuing invoices. Accountants take the data bookkeepers compile and use it for high-level tasks like preparing financial statements, guiding business strategy, and filing taxes.

Most small businesses need both bookkeeping and higher-level accounting. A single accountant can provide both services, or you can hire a separate bookkeeper. If hiring both, ensure they communicate and regularly share data.

When should you hire an accountant?

Consider hiring an accountant if:

  • You need help selecting accounting systems and software for your business.
  • You need help with complex finances like managing investments, real estate, or international transactions.
  • Don't have the time or the training to do daily bookkeeping and accounting tasks yourself.
  • You need tax expertise to help maximize your return and prevent tax errors or penalties.
  • You're looking to identify cost reductions and growth opportunities.
  • You're preparing for an audit or sale and need to verify accurate financial statements.
  • You notice errors in your current system and need an expert to review processes and improve internal controls.

How do I choose an accountant near me?

The right accountant-client relationship can provide tremendous value to your business. Take the time to research options thoroughly before deciding who to hire. When researching accountants near you:

  • Ask for referrals from business owners in your industry.
  • Review credentials like CPA licensing, education, specializations.
  • Ask them for a free consultation and meet with them to discuss your needs.
  • Compare detailed estimates from at least 3 potential accountants.
  • Ask for client references and read client reviews on Lawful and Google.
  • Clearly communicate your expectations and budget.
  • Look for an accountant who communicates clearly and answers your questions in understandable terms.
  • Prioritize trust and rapport, as your accountant handles sensitive financial data.
  • Consider both large established CPA firms and smaller local professionals.
